Determining Your Solar Power Needs

How Many Watts of Solar Panels to Run a House

When it comes to figuring out how much solar power you need, the first step is to assess your household’s energy consumption. This process involves understanding your average electricity usage, which is typically measured in kilowatt-hours (kWh). Here’s how to get started:

1. Check Your Utility Bills: Look at your electricity bills for the past year. Most bills will show your monthly kWh usage.
2. Calculate Your Average Daily Usage: Divide your total annual kWh by 365 to find your average daily consumption.

For example, if your annual usage is 12,000 kWh, your average daily usage would be:

12,000 kWh / 365 days = 32.88 kWh per day.

3. Determine Solar Panel Output: The output of solar panels varies based on their wattage and the amount of sunlight they receive. On average, a solar panel produces about 300 watts under optimal conditions.

4. Calculate Required Wattage: To find out how many watts of solar panels you need, you can use the following formula:

Required Wattage = (Daily kWh Usage / Sunlight Hours) * 1000

Assuming you receive about 5 hours of sunlight per day, you can calculate:

Required Wattage = (32.88 kWh / 5 hours) * 1000 = 6576 watts.

This means you would need approximately 6.6 kW of solar panels to meet your daily energy needs.

Practical Examples

How Many Watts of Solar Panels to Run a House?

Let’s break this down with a practical example. Consider a household that uses 900 kWh per month:

– Monthly Usage: 900 kWh
– Daily Usage: 900 kWh / 30 = 30 kWh
– Sunlight Hours: 5 hours

Using the formula:

Required Wattage = (30 kWh / 5 hours) * 1000 = 6000 watts.

In this case, the household would need around 6 kW of solar panels.

Benefits of Solar Energy

Switching to solar energy comes with a host of benefits:

  • Cost Savings: Reduced electricity bills and potential tax incentives.
  • Energy Independence: Less reliance on fossil fuels and utility companies.
  • Environmental Impact: Lower carbon footprint and reduced greenhouse gas emissions.
  • Increased Property Value: Homes with solar panels often sell for more.

Challenges and Limitations

While solar energy is a fantastic option, it’s not without its challenges:

  • Initial Costs: The upfront investment can be significant, although financing options are available.
  • Weather Dependency: Solar panels are less effective on cloudy days or during winter months.
  • Space Requirements: Not all homes have the roof space needed for sufficient solar panels.
  • Energy Storage Costs: If you want to store energy for nighttime use, battery systems can be expensive.

Quick Reference Table

Household Size Average Monthly Usage (kWh) Required Solar Panel Wattage (kW)
1-2 People 300-600 3-5
3-4 People 600-900 5-7
5+ People 900-1200 7-10

By understanding your energy needs and the factors that influence solar panel output, you can make an informed decision about how much solar power is necessary to run your home efficiently.

Myth Debunked

A common myth is that solar panels are ineffective in cloudy or rainy climates. While it’s true that solar panels generate less energy on overcast days, they can still produce a significant amount of power. In fact, many solar systems are designed to operate efficiently even in less-than-ideal weather conditions.
